Implementation of purchasing reporting with SAP BI supported by agile project methodology

The client is one of the world’s leading development banks and thus responsible for financially securing the realization of public contracts. Around 5,000 employees manage total assets of around half a trillion euros.

The initial situation

  • The central purchasing department and the customer’s internal IT department were looking for a new implementation partner for a failed purchasing controlling project.
  • The failure was caused by technical problems (poor performance of the reporting frontend) and poor data quality.

The solution

  • Evaluation of different frontends and recommendation of a frontend strategy
  • Agile, risk-oriented project approach with the goal of being able to deliver and validate results at an early stage
  • Deployment of a small cross-functional team with deep purchasing process knowledge

The success

  • The requirements critical to success were identified and implemented at an early stage
  • Unnecessary developments as well as undesirable developments were minimized by regular assessment and feedback rounds with the department
  • Educate client teams on benefits, challenges as well as best practices of an agile project methodology.
  • Successful project completion in close cooperation with internal IT and the business despite high complexity and time pressure
